About the Role The Behavior Technician (BT) provides direct, one-on-one ABA services to children and adolescents in home, school, and community settings under the supervision of a Board Certified Behavior Analyst (BCBA). In this role, you will: Implement individualized treatment plans designed by a BCBA Use evidence-based ABA strategies including DTT, NET, behavior reduction, and skill acquisition Collect accurate session data (e.g., ABC data, frequency, duration) to monitor progress Support skill development in communication, social skills, daily living skills, and emotional regulation Collaborate with caregivers and clinical team members to promote consistency and skill generalization Maintain ethical, professional, and compassionate care aligned with BACB standards and company policies Behavior Technicians at Nurture & Nature ABA receive ongoing supervision, mentorship, and training and are supported with balanced caseloads within a 20-mile service radius to promote quality care and clinician sustainability.
